Pakistan, India, Bangladesh, and Sri Lanka share a major milestone - gaining independence from British Rule. How each country moved forward is unique and contextualized to each region. In relation to architecture, these countries were collectively faced with housing crises, the restoration of heritage buildings, and a need for public institutions. A wave of decolonization washed over South Asia, utilizing modern architecture as a vehicle to liberate from the colonial period. Presenting your big, bold ideas.
